Our second anthology features an eclectic selection of poets from Lancashire and Cumbria: David Borrott, Elizabeth Burns, Mark Griffiths, Pauline Keith and Cath Nichols

Each with their distinctive style and urgency, at least one of these poets will speak directly to you, but we are confident you will find resonance with at least one poem of each poet.

From a slaughteryard to Woolworths, St Francis to Shakespeare, the directness and intimacy of these poems is unnerving and agile, but always assured. Their resilience hints at the strength of human will, imagination and hope, offering the reader moments of cautious optimism and the gift of seeing the world anew.
